The Definition and Age Limits of Adolescence
Adolescence is a period of significant physical, emotional, and social development that occurs between childhood and adulthood. It is often considered a transitional stage in human development, characterized by rapid changes and challenges. The age at which adolescence begins and ends varies among individuals and cultures, but it generally occurs between the ages of 10 and 19.
During this time, young people experience puberty, a period of rapid physical growth and sexual maturation. This is when secondary sexual characteristics develop, such as breast growth in girls and facial hair in boys. Hormones play a significant role in these changes, influencing mood swings, energy levels, and overall behavior.
In addition to physical changes, adolescents also undergo significant cognitive and emotional development. They begin to form their own identity, beliefs, and values, often questioning societal norms and authority figures. This can lead to conflicts with parents and other adults, as they seek independence and autonomy.
Socially, adolescents are navigating relationships with peers, developing friendships, and exploring romantic interests. They are also faced with important decisions about their future, such as education, career paths, and personal goals.
The challenges of adolescence can vary widely depending on individual circumstances, such as family dynamics, socioeconomic status, and cultural background. Factors such as peer pressure, academic stress, and exposure to drugs and alcohol can also impact an adolescent's development.
Despite the challenges, adolescence is also a time of great potential and growth. It is a period of discovery, self-exploration, and learning. It is a time when young people are developing skills and competencies that will serve them throughout their lives.
In conclusion, adolescence is a complex and dynamic period of human development that encompasses physical, emotional, and social changes. While the age limits of adolescence are fluid and vary among individuals, it is generally a time of transition between childhood and adulthood. It is a time of both challenges and opportunities, as young people navigate the complexities of growing up and becoming independent individuals.。
